What they do

A Packager consolidates and packages goods for safe and efficient storage and transport. Works at a factory or at a trade or transportation facility.

Job Description

Picker/Packer Entry Level Zogalo Foods West Chicago, IL Job Details Full-time $16.50 - $21.00 an hour 18 hours ago Qualifications Packing Forklift Warehouse experience Materials handling Picking & packing Full Job Description Job Summary Join our team as a picker/packer and become a part of our growing business. This position includes hours of 7 am - 3:30 pm. You will be responsible for picking, packing, and preparing products for shipment while adhering to safety protocols. Responsibilities Efficiently pick items using order picker equipment and barcode scanning technology to ensure accurate order fulfillment. Pack products securely using proper packaging techniques to prevent damage during transit. Operate warehouse equipment such as pallet jacks, reach trucks, forklifts, and other heavy machinery following safety guidelines. Assist with inventory management by stocking shelves, conducting stock counts, and updating inventory management systems. Load and unload shipments safely using appropriate material handling equipment while adhering to safety protocols. Support shipping and receiving processes by verifying incoming and outgoing shipments against documentation. Maintain cleanliness and organization of the warehouse workspace to promote safety and efficiency. Experience Previous warehouse experience or familiarity with warehouse operations is preferred but not required; training will be provided. Basic math skills for counting, measuring, and verifying quantities accurately. Strong attention to detail in order picking, packing quality control, and inventory accuracy. Ability to work effectively in a team environment with good communication skills.
